What is an Accident Lawyer?
An Motor Vehicle Accident Attorney lawyer, likewise called a personal injury attorney, specializes in representing customers who have actually suffered injuries as an outcome of accidents triggered by the negligence or misbehavior of others. Their primary goal is to guarantee that victims get the compensation they are worthy of for their losses, which might consist of medical expenditures, lost salaries, pain and suffering, and more.

Comprehending the legal process can reduce some stress and anxiety for accident victims. Here is an easy breakdown of what to expect when dealing with an Accident Injury Settlement Attorney lawyer:
Consultation: The lawyer evaluates your case and figures out if you have a legitimate claim.Investigation: They collect evidence to support your case, such as accident reports and medical records.Need Letter: The lawyer sends out a need letter to the responsible celebration or insurer describing your damages.Settlement: The lawyer works out a settlement. If an agreement can not be reached, the case might continue to court.Litigation: If necessary, the case is brought to justice, where the lawyer represents you during the trial.Resolution: The case concludes with either a settlement arrangement or a court decision.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How much does it cost to employ an accident lawyer?
Most accident legal representatives work on a contingency charge basis, indicating they only make money if you win your case. Their fees generally vary from 25% to 40% of the overall settlement or award.
2. How long do I have to sue?
The statute of constraints differs by state and kind of accident, however it generally ranges from one to 3 years from the date of the accident.
3. What if I was partly at fault for the accident?
Many states follow a relative carelessness guideline, indicating your compensation may be lowered based on your percentage of fault. An accident lawyer can assist you browse these intricacies.
4. Will my case go to trial?
A lot of accident cases are settled out of court. However, if a reasonable settlement can not be reached, your lawyer may recommend taking your case to trial.
